Spaces:
Sleeping
Sleeping
Gallinator commited on
visualization: fix delete key press not always detected
Browse files
app/static/js/visualization.js
CHANGED
|
@@ -128,11 +128,13 @@ class CurveEditor {
|
|
| 128 |
this.handler = { onupdate: () => { } }
|
| 129 |
|
| 130 |
this.div.ownerDocument.addEventListener("keydown", (event) => {
|
| 131 |
-
|
|
|
|
| 132 |
this.isDeleteKeyDown = true
|
| 133 |
})
|
| 134 |
this.div.ownerDocument.addEventListener("keyup", (event) => {
|
| 135 |
-
|
|
|
|
| 136 |
this.isDeleteKeyDown = false
|
| 137 |
})
|
| 138 |
|
|
|
|
| 128 |
this.handler = { onupdate: () => { } }
|
| 129 |
|
| 130 |
this.div.ownerDocument.addEventListener("keydown", (event) => {
|
| 131 |
+
console.log(event)
|
| 132 |
+
if (event.key == "Control")
|
| 133 |
this.isDeleteKeyDown = true
|
| 134 |
})
|
| 135 |
this.div.ownerDocument.addEventListener("keyup", (event) => {
|
| 136 |
+
console.log(event)
|
| 137 |
+
if (event.key == "Control")
|
| 138 |
this.isDeleteKeyDown = false
|
| 139 |
})
|
| 140 |
|